Serena Williams and Alexis Ohanian got married in 2017 after Williams gave birth to Olympia. Fast forward five years, and the couple, last month, celebrated their five-year anniversary.

However, while the whole world was adoring the couple, fans thought that one person might not be very happy with it; Serena’s ex-boyfriend, Drake. The Canadian rapper and singer, Drake, recently called Alexis Ohanian, ‘a groupie’ in his song, ‘Middle of the Ocean’.

However, fans pointed out the strong relationship between the couple and took a dig at him for calling out Ohanian. The rumored ex-boyfriend Drake, apparently, has not yet moved on. Whereas the couple seems to be enjoying their time with their little daughter.
